Output fc75e47a6302633e3a93bca4894f68361116ead77f81e07541a4f29ec898963b:1

value
23623215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ca6aae6ba0bc3ea601ddea35e4299b22153576c OP_EQUALVERIFY OP_CHECKSIG
address
16XhCn3CUf8G7Z8wQ4thzDC64BQqwuk8Nm
transaction
fc75e47a6302633e3a93bca4894f68361116ead77f81e07541a4f29ec898963b
spent
true